In-Line Transit Time Ultrasonic Flow Meter Market Size

The global In-Line Transit Time Ultrasonic Flow Meter market was valued at US$ 463 million in 2025 and is anticipated to reach US$ 701 million by 2032, at a CAGR of 6.2% from 2026 to 2032.

An In-Line Transit Time Ultrasonic Flow Meter is a type of flow meter that measures the flow rate of a fluid by using ultrasonic waves. This type of flow meter operates on the principle of measuring the time it takes for ultrasonic signals to travel between two or more transducers in the flow stream. The transit time of the ultrasonic signals is affected by the velocity of the fluid, allowing the flow meter to calculate the flow rate.
Ongoing efforts to enhance the accuracy and precision of transit time ultrasonic flow meters through advancements in signal processing algorithms, calibration methods, and sensor technologies.
